CHELSEA ACADEMYJOB DESCRIPTION
JOB TITLE: Dean of Students/Athletic Director
Job Purpose Statement: This blended position will combine the function of "Dean of Students" and "Athletic Director". As such, the incumbent's function is for the purpose/s of overall student management including non-curricular activities, discipline and he or she will also develop, manage, and supervise the school's athletic programs.
In the function as Dean of Students he or she will be responsible for ensuring that Chelsea Academy establishes and maintains a positive culture of behavior and learning, supporting teachers in behavior management and student discipline. He or she will oversee the efforts of the Student Life Coordinator and ultimately be responsible for action required due to disciplinary infractions, as well as overseeing the planning and execution of all student activities that are not academic in nature. He or she will monitor attendance infractions of students, communicate with parents regarding attendance matters, and enact appropriate disciplinary measures for students with chronic attendance problems.
In the function of Athletic Director he or she will be responsible for seasonal Chelsea sports teams, including the procurement of coaches, scheduling of games, scheduling of officials, and the securing of facilities for practices and games.

Specific duties relating to the function of Athletic Director:
Develop, manage, and supervise developmentally appropriate athletic programs in line with the school's overall educational mission and goals
Represent Chelsea Academy in all league and athletic associations and attend all meetings with those organizations.
Schedule all middle school, junior varsity, and varsity contests for the school's interscholastic teams.
Ensure that all coaching positions are filled with competent, vetted, and properly trained coaches.
Supervise, develop, and evaluate all coaches.
Oversee the distribution, collection, storage, upkeep, and replacement of all school athletic uniforms and equipment.
Ensure that athletic fields and facilities are prepared for hosting athletic contests and practices.
Communicate with students and parents regarding appropriate expectations for each level of competition.
Ensure that all athletic equipment, facilities, fields, and courts are safe for daily use.
Maintain accurate records of athletic statistics and accomplishments.
Organize coaches' meetings at the beginning of each season to review expectations, guidelines, and rules of play.
Schedule transportation for all away athletic contests.
Secure qualified officials for each home contest.
Update athletic calendar on school website with schedules and locations of all interscholastic games.
Oversee planning of season specific sports awards functions.
